Strike on Energy Facility in Chernihiv Region: What is the Situation with Electricity.
According to inkorr.com: In Chernihiv region, electricity outages continue due to the shelling of an energy facility by the enemy. Employees of energy companies are actively working on organizing alternative power supplies for hospitals, communal services, and social institutions. In Chernihiv, transportation is also switching to generators, and mobile operators are adhering to prepared scenarios in case of power outages.
Police Patrols and Government Response
The police have intensified patrols in settlements without electricity. The situation arising after the attack by Russian troops on the energy facility in the Chernihiv region has been classified as a terrorist act. The President of Ukraine has warned about a possible symmetrical response in the event of such actions being repeated.
